LWL-Industriemuseum Zeche Nachtigall
Zeche Nachtigall in Witten-Bommern is one of the oldest surviving colliery sites in the Ruhr region, now home to an outpost of the LWL Industrial Museum network. Coal was extracted here as early as the first half of the 19th century, and the preserved shaft structures, tunnel entrances, and engine houses make the region's industrial transformation tangible. Since 2003 the site has served as an anchor point on the Route of Industrial Heritage and as an information centre for the Ruhr Region Geopark, offering underground tours and permanent exhibitions on mining history. Admission is charged; the entire site is wheelchair accessible.
